Transaction 50521b1555417b25187293488dda7340c168c4250078453869e70087f6bf0ce8

2 Input
2 Outputs
  • 50521b1555417b25187293488dda7340c168c4250078453869e70087f6bf0ce8:0
  • value  1848688
    address  39hmnqCfgynbY1Gi1zkVHbjQ5fHVK4dTdS
  • 50521b1555417b25187293488dda7340c168c4250078453869e70087f6bf0ce8:1
  • value  149314
    address  1LqyZNeYrgzgiszSDPTQzuXKZQKe4rWu94